Vanilla Bean Crème Brulee
Serves: 11
Serving Size: 2 ¾ oz
2 ¼ C. Fage® Yogurt
1 ½ Packages Vanilla Pudding Mix
1 C. Coconut Milk
½ t. Agar
¼ Vanilla Bean
Topping:
5 ½ t. Cane Sugar
Start by whisking coconut milk and agar together and putting it to boil. Just when it starts to boil turn the heat down to your light simmer, and let heat for 4-5 minutes. Blend all ingredients together well. Pour mixture into a pastry bag, or Ziploc® with a corner cut off, and squeeze 2 ¾ oz portions into porcelain ramekins. Place all ramekins in refrigerator to chill. Dessert ought to be set up in about 2 hours. Just before serving desserts, sprinkle ½ t. cane sugar evenly on top, and fire it off with torch, prior to the top from the Crème Brulee is caramelized.

When presented with a choice, always select the least processing option. For example, if you are in front of the machine, you can see the peanut butter cookies, chocolate bars, pop, pretzels and nuts. Of these I would choose the nuts. Of course, if a package is likely to be roasted and salted, but I bet the ingredients list is much shorter than the other options. Ideally, products packaged receive 5 ingredients or less.
